Crawlspace Sealing in Birmingham, AL
Crawlspace sealing services involve applying specialized materials to close gaps, cracks, and vents in a property's crawlspace to prevent unwanted air, moisture, and pests from entering. This process helps improve energy efficiency by reducing air leaks and can also protect the home’s foundation from moisture-related issues. Projects typically include sealing around vents, access points, and foundation walls, as well as insulating and vapor barrier installation to create a more controlled environment underneath the home.
Homeowners considering crawlspace sealing often want to understand how the service can impact indoor comfort, energy bills, and long-term property health. It’s important to evaluate the current condition of the crawlspace, identify existing issues such as excess moisture or pests, and determine the scope of sealing needed. Proper sealing can contribute to a healthier indoor environment and help maintain the structural integrity of the home, making it a valuable step in property maintenance and improvement.

Common Crawlspace Sealing Jobs
Crawlspace Sealing - sealing gaps and cracks to prevent air leaks and improve energy efficiency.
Moisture Barrier Installation - installing vapor barriers to reduce humidity and prevent mold growth.
Insulation Sealing - securing and sealing insulation to enhance thermal performance.
Ventilation Sealing - blocking unwanted vents to maintain proper airflow and reduce energy loss.
Pest Barrier Sealing - sealing entry points to keep pests out of the crawlspace area.
Air Leak Detection - identifying and sealing leaks to improve indoor comfort and lower utility bills.
Crawlspace Sealing Questions
What is crawlspace sealing? Crawlspace sealing involves closing off vents, gaps, and access points to prevent unwanted airflow, moisture, and pests from entering the space.
Why is sealing a crawlspace important? Proper sealing helps improve energy efficiency, prevents mold growth, and reduces the risk of pest infestations in the home.
What materials are used for crawlspace sealing? Common materials include vapor barriers, sealant tapes, and spray foam insulation to create a tight, moisture-resistant barrier.
What types of issues can crawlspace sealing address? Sealing can help mitigate humidity problems, reduce energy costs, and prevent structural damage caused by moisture infiltration.
